Tach allerseits ...
Ich bin noch recht unerfahren in Webprogrammierung und nun hab folgendes Problem:
Ich will eine über eine suchMaske.jsp eine suchmaske aufbauen.
Diese soll über 2 dropdown menus die suche einschränken.
das erste dropdopwn menu soll mit diversen "options" gefüllt sein, ion diesem Fall mit Tabellennamen von Tabellen die in einer Datenbank existieren (Datenbeschaffung über ein Servlet).
Soweit hab ich das hinbekommen, aber nun das Problem:
Die "options" im zweiten Dropdownmenu sollen erst gefüllt werden (und auch erst dann vom Server geladen werden), wenn im ersten Dropdownmenu die gewünschte Tabelle ausgesucht wurde. Diese Auswahl bestimmt dann erst, welche Feldernamen im zweiten Dropdown rein sollen.
Da ich noch nicht den vollen Durchblick über die ganzen Möglichkeiten in Zusammenhang von jsp, Servlet und Javascript habe, habe ich prinzipiell folgende Lösung probiert:
Das ändern des ersten Dropdownmenüs ("onchanged") ruft eine JavaScript Funktion auf, die dann das zweite Dropdown füllen soll und auch die nötigen Feldernamen über ein Servlet beschaffen soll.
Und da liegt der Hase im Pfeffer begraben ...
scheinbar kann ich aus Javascript nicht ohne weiteres oder sogar übberhaupt nicht auf Servlet zurückgreifen ... das Script kannt das Servlet nicht ...
Hat jemand eine helfende Idee ?? oder sogar neh besseren Lösungsweg als über JS nen Servlet aufzurufen ...
Allerdings ein Lösung über ein Applet steht leider nicht zur Option.
Herzlichen Dank ...
Lemy
Ich bin noch recht unerfahren in Webprogrammierung und nun hab folgendes Problem:
Ich will eine über eine suchMaske.jsp eine suchmaske aufbauen.
Diese soll über 2 dropdown menus die suche einschränken.
das erste dropdopwn menu soll mit diversen "options" gefüllt sein, ion diesem Fall mit Tabellennamen von Tabellen die in einer Datenbank existieren (Datenbeschaffung über ein Servlet).
Soweit hab ich das hinbekommen, aber nun das Problem:
Die "options" im zweiten Dropdownmenu sollen erst gefüllt werden (und auch erst dann vom Server geladen werden), wenn im ersten Dropdownmenu die gewünschte Tabelle ausgesucht wurde. Diese Auswahl bestimmt dann erst, welche Feldernamen im zweiten Dropdown rein sollen.
Da ich noch nicht den vollen Durchblick über die ganzen Möglichkeiten in Zusammenhang von jsp, Servlet und Javascript habe, habe ich prinzipiell folgende Lösung probiert:
Das ändern des ersten Dropdownmenüs ("onchanged") ruft eine JavaScript Funktion auf, die dann das zweite Dropdown füllen soll und auch die nötigen Feldernamen über ein Servlet beschaffen soll.
Und da liegt der Hase im Pfeffer begraben ...
scheinbar kann ich aus Javascript nicht ohne weiteres oder sogar übberhaupt nicht auf Servlet zurückgreifen ... das Script kannt das Servlet nicht ...
Hat jemand eine helfende Idee ?? oder sogar neh besseren Lösungsweg als über JS nen Servlet aufzurufen ...
Allerdings ein Lösung über ein Applet steht leider nicht zur Option.
Herzlichen Dank ...
Lemy